Summary

In this long-format interview, Agnès Pannier-Runacher, former French minister for ecological transition, discusses her career trajectory from business leadership to politics. She details her roles in managing crises such as the COVID-19 pandemic, the energy crisis following the Ukraine invasion, and agricultural protests. She defends the government’s approach to anticipation and decision-making, emphasizing the challenges of democratic debate and political polarization. She elaborates on France’s energy strategy, advocating for a mix of nuclear and renewables, and highlights the importance of reducing dependence on fossil fuels. The interview also touches on her experience with industrial policy, the role of intelligence in government, and the difficulties of implementing long-term policies in a fragmented political landscape.
